5-7-4. Auto Check

This test mode performs CREC and CPLAY automatically for mainly checking the characteristics of the optical pick-up. To perform this test mode, the laser power must first be checked. Perform Auto Check after the laser power check and Iop compare.

Procedure:

1.Click the [ENTER/YES]. If “LDPWR ” is displayed, it means that the laser power check has not been performed. In this case, perform the laser power check and Iop compare, and then repeat from step 1.

2.If a disc is in the mechanical deck, it will be ejected forcibly. “DISC IN” will be displayed in this case. Load a test disc (MDW- 74/GA-1) which can be recorded.

3.If a disk is loaded at step 2, the check will start automatically.

4.When “XX CHECK” is displayed, the item corresponding to XX will be performed.

When “06 CHECK” completes, the disc loaded at step 2 will be ejected. “DISC IN” will be displayed. Load the check disc (MD) TDYS-1.

5.When the disc is loaded, the check will automatically be resumed from “07 CHECK”.

6.After completing to test item “12 check”, check OK or NG will be displayed. If all items are OK, “CHECK ALL OK” will be displayed. If any item is NG, it will be displayed as “NG:xxxx”.

When “CHECK ALL OK” is displayed, it means that the optical pick-up is normal. Check the operations of the other spindle motor, sled motor, etc.

When displayed as “NG:xxxx”, it means that the optical pick-up is faulty. In this case, replace the optical pick-up.

5-7-6. Traverse Check

Note 1: Data will be erased during MO reading if a recorded disc is used in this adjustment.

Note 2: If the traverse waveform is not clear, connect the oscilloscope as shown in the following figure so that it can be seen more clearly.

Checking Procedure:

1.Connect an oscilloscope to CN105 pin 4 (TE) and CN105 pin 6 (VC) on the BD (MD) board.

2.Load a disc (any available on the market). (Refer to Note 1)

3.Click the [FF] to move the optical pick-up outside the pit and click the [STOP] to stop.

4.Click the [JOG UP] or [JOG DOWN] to display “EF MO CHECK”(C14).

5.Click the [ENTER/YES] to display “EFB = MO-R”. (Laser power READ power/Focus servo ON/tracking servo OFF/spindle (S) servo ON)

6.Observe the waveform of the oscilloscope, and check that the specified value is satisfied. Do not click the [JOG UP] or

[JOG DOWN].

(Read power traverse checking)
